Edition of Pilgrim’s Progress in Welsh with tipped in illustrations. In good condition, the boards are loose and there is foxing throughout along with evidence of handling, i.e., fingerprints and so forth. Writing inside front: “Pilgrim’s Progress in Welsh”, “Among the books of Jane R. Williams (WRW Aug 1925)” and on facing page, there is faded “John T Thomas/Book Trenton(?)/April 12 1846” and below that a stamped “J.F. Thomas” which stamp is repeated on next page. There are several tipped in illustrations marked “Harvey” and “Anderson”. There is no date but we estimate the publication as early to mid 1800s, most likely 1830s due to publisher and printer D. Fanshaw’s imprint.
